URGENT UPDATE
 
The Over 35 State Championships will now NOT be held in Townsville over the May Long Weekend.  As Mackay is the only centre outside  SE Qld who is fielding a team in this division, it did not make sense to ask all the centres from SE Qld to travel to Townsville to play each other.
 
The Over 35 State Championships will now be played on the Gold Coast (Labrador) on the weekend of 9/10 May. Games will start midday Sat 9 May.

INKEY MILLETT AWARD
 
Each year Qld Vets present this award to someone who has given outstanding service to hockey throughout his career.  For more information about this award, past recipients and the criteria please look on the "AWARD" page of the website.
 
HOW TO NOMINATE SOMEONE FOR 2009:
 
Due Date:   30 June
  • Send a letter outlining your reasons for nomination to the Secretary of Qld Vets - secretary@qldmensvetshockey.com
  • The letter should give detailed information regarding the nominee and his service to Hockey.
  • This award is a service award and not an achievement award.

NATIONAL CHAMPIONSHIPS MELBOURNE 2009
 
These will be held from 26 Sept to 10 Oct.  The championships will not be held at the State Hockey Centre but at two suburban centres.  The accommodation for the Qld teams has been tentatively booked and organised.  It is expected that cost will be around $60 per person per night. UNIFORMS
 
As many of you will be aware, this year we will have complete new uniforms.  It has been 3 years since we have changed the uniform - uniforms were due to change last year but because of the additional expense of travelling to Darwin it was decided to delay the costs of uniforms until 2009.  It looks as thought the 2010 championships will be in West Australia so again it will be an expensive trip.
